Output 751822942eee28f15778764c4f89bef445f59bc9476cffb8d77465fc9481d6b4:1

value
1628208
script pubkey
OP_0 OP_PUSHBYTES_20 0583a1081282d75683ec587d7713d43058ad16a0
address
bc1qqkp6zzqjstt4dqlvtp7hwy75xpv2694qk4335k
transaction
751822942eee28f15778764c4f89bef445f59bc9476cffb8d77465fc9481d6b4
confirmations
89188
spent
true